The quit: where several cases are won
The Constitution does not disappear when blue lights blink. A police officer needs a sensible basis to pull an automobile over. That can be a website traffic infraction or clear indicators of disability, however it must be specific and articulable. "Weaving" without lane separation, as an example, commonly shows up in records yet breaks down under video clip evaluation. I have seen dashcam video footage where a driver touched the fog line once on a dark, windy roadway, after that drove or else flawlessly for miles. That is not problems. That is driving.
There are additionally pretense quits. A plate-light bulb out can be enough for a stop; it can not, by itself, warrant an extended apprehension for a DUI fishing expedition. The minute the reason for the stop has been settled, the clock begins ticking. Officers require brand-new facts to prolong the encounter. When they can not articulate those facts, we submit to suppress every little thing that followed the unlawful apprehension. If the court omits the evidence, the instance generally drops apart.
Field sobriety tests: scientific research when done right, junk when done wrong
Standardized area soberness examinations have rules. They are intended to be provided on a sensibly level surface area, with appropriate directions and presentations, and racked up according to a released guidebook. Leave out a step or misapply the ideas, and the "scientific research" sheds its foundation.

I as soon as stood for a customer who "failed" the walk-and-turn due to the fact that he started too soon. The officer had not finished the directions, after that marked 2 separate ideas for the same early beginning. On cross, we went through each instruction line by line. The jurors saw what took place. The state's proof shifted from authority to confusion. The innocent came fast.
Horizontal stare nystagmus is one more usual battleground. The examination hinges on exact timing, distance, and stimulus speed. Most records skip those details, however bodycam typically catches them. If the officer never held the stimulation at maximum variance for 4 seconds, real HGN can not be reliably called. An aggressive protection checks the video clip first, not the report.
Breath and blood testing: equipments, upkeep, and margins of error
Breath equipments do not convict; records do. Every device has an upkeep log. Every calibration has a resistance. Every mouth alcohol catch has limitations. Title 17 in The golden state, as an example, sets stringent requirements for breath screening procedures, observation durations, and tools checks. Various other states have similar management codes. When companies do not follow them, the test result becomes vulnerable.
I handled a situation where 2 successive breath samples showed a 0.05 spread. The driver ran a third examination and selected the greater set to report. Cross exposed that the device had flagged "ambient air interference" previously that week. With a specialist's assistance, we equated those logs right into simple language for the court. The court left out the breath results, and the state accepted lower the charge.
Blood tests carry their very own risks. Chain of wardship should be impermeable. The package expiration day issues, as does preservative ratio. Hemolysis adjustments readings. Fermentation can create alcohol in the vial. A laboratory analyst who set processes examples without correct controls is a present to any kind of serious defense. We summon the data, not simply the shiny laboratory record. When essential, we have an independent laboratory re-test the maintained sample. Greater than when, retesting has reduced a reported result by purposeful factors or appeared contamination that the state lab missed.
Timing issues: DMV hearings and very early intervention
The clock starts running the moment of arrest. In several states you have as little as 10 days to demand a DMV or management hearing to challenge the certificate suspension. Miss that window, and your driving advantages can be restricted or revoked before you ever before see a court. That is why a 24/7 criminal defense attorney line is not marketing fluff, it is a functional need. I have actually taken telephone calls at 1:30 a.m., emailed the DMV request by dawn, and maintained a client's right to a hearing that later subjected a defective observation period prior to the breath test.
Early intervention likewise lets us secure down surveillance video from nearby organizations, safe and secure witness declarations, and record the scene while it is fresh. Skid marks discolor. Climate modifications. A sharp defense treats the roadside like a criminal offense scene in reverse, protecting realities the state might ignore.

When breath is under 0.08 but the cost still sticks
Many drivers are surprised to discover you can be billed with DUI also if your chemical examination checks out under the statutory restriction. District attorneys in some cases proceed on impairment theory: driving pattern, area examinations, and monitorings. These instances commonly look weak, however they can hurt if a judge credit scores the officer's testament. The defense tactic changes. We highlight typical driving segments, highlight ecological elements like unequal pavement or heavy boots, and generate an expert to describe how anxiety and roadside problems impact efficiency. Jurors that expect a difficult number often tend to doubt impairment without it, yet they need to be shown why the policeman's narrative overreaches.
Prescription medicine and "legal" substances
DUI is not limited to alcohol. Anxiety drugs, sleep help, painkiller, and even allergic reaction medication can harm driving. Marijuana complicates the photo better. Blood levels do not line up nicely with problems for THC, and courts recognize this. The prosecution commonly counts on a Medicine Acknowledgment Critic. Their lists look excellent, yet they are subjective and susceptible to confirmation prejudice. An aggressive protection tests the DRE's training, uniformity, and the clinical underpinnings of the test. We in some cases bring in a pharmacologist to clarify half-life, resistance, and specific irregularity. These situations demand scientific research, not slogans.
Accidents, injuries, and felony exposure
DUI with an accident, specifically with injury, adjustments everything. Restitution, victim effect, and public safety and security problems enter the space. Right here, very early reduction matters as much as constitutional difficulties. We coordinate with insurance, record medical repayments, and, where ideal, participate in organized restitution prior to arraignment. Juries notification. I have actually reduced possible prison time to different safekeeping by showing validated therapy registration, evidence of complete restitution, and letters from supervisors detailing work obligations that serve clients or patients.
When the case escalates to felony region, experienced sources broaden. Mishap repair can refute speed estimates. A biomechanical engineer might challenge the assumption that the customer created the crash. If the other vehicle driver made an abrupt lane adjustment or an unlawful turn, causation ends up being a real-time issue. Felony DUI tests call for careful prep and a sober discussion concerning threat resistance, including immigration and licensing fallout.

After the case: sealing, expungement, and returning to normal
Finishing court is not completion. Expungement or record relief may be available after probation. Some states allow very early discontinuation when obligations are total. Ignition interlock programs can reduce certificate constraints. SR-22 insurance coverage needs ultimately finish, yet you must schedule them. Companies frequently need verification letters. Expert licensing boards value evidence of finished treatment and tidy screening. An excellent defense lawyer remains with clients long enough to shut these loops, not simply to refine the plea.

Why some situations must go peaceful and others ought to go loud
There is an art to making a decision when to file an activity that attracts attention versus when to construct a record quietly. A suppression activity can win a situation, yet it likewise offers the prosecution a preview of your cross and a chance to fix sloppy documentation. On a close phone call, I may hold the motion up until I confirm the policeman's testament will certainly not match the report, then spring it at the hearing. Conversely, if a breath machine's maintenance background is undeniably negative, a very early motion can force disclosures that take advantage of a better appeal prior to the state scrambles to substitute evidence.
Aggressive defense is not concerning doing every little thing. It has to do with doing the appropriate thing at the ideal time.
